java.lang.NoSuchMethodError: org.hibernate.integrator.internal.IntegratorServiceImpl
2017-02-21 00:07
1611 查看
1、错误描述
INFO: HHH000206: hibernate.properties not found
Exception in thread "main" java.lang.NoSuchMethodError: org.hibernate.integrator.internal.IntegratorServiceImpl.<init>(Ljava/util/LinkedHashSet;Lorg/hibernate/service/classloading/spi/ClassLoaderService;)V
at org.hibernate.service.internal.BootstrapServiceRegistryImpl.<init>(BootstrapServiceRegistryImpl.java:80)
at org.hibernate.service.internal.BootstrapServiceRegistryImpl.<init>(BootstrapServiceRegistryImpl.java:57)
at org.hibernate.service.ServiceRegistryBuilder.<init>(ServiceRegistryBuilder.java:76)
at com.you.hibernate.HibernateSessionFactory.<clinit>(HibernateSessionFactory.java:33)
at com.you.hibernate.dao.StudentDao.findAll(StudentDao.java:25)
at com.you.hibernate.dao.StudentDao.main(StudentDao.java:39)
2、错误原因
/**
*
*/
package com.you.hibernate.dao;
import java.util.ArrayList;
import java.util.List;
import org.hibernate.Session;
import org.hibernate.query.Query;
import com.you.hibernate.HibernateSessionFactory;
import com.you.hibernate.model.TStudentInfo;
/**
* @author Administrator
*
*/
public class StudentDao
{
@SuppressWarnings({ "unchecked", "rawtypes" })
public static List<TStudentInfo> findAll()
{
List<TStudentInfo> list = null;
Session session = HibernateSessionFactory.getSession();
Query query = session.createQuery("from TStudentInfo ");
list = query.list();
session.close();
return list;
}
/**
* @param args
*/
public static void main(String[] args)
{
List<TStudentInfo> list = new ArrayList<TStudentInfo>();
list = findAll();
System.out.println(list.size());
}
}
3、解决办法
INFO: HHH000206: hibernate.properties not found
Exception in thread "main" java.lang.NoSuchMethodError: org.hibernate.integrator.internal.IntegratorServiceImpl.<init>(Ljava/util/LinkedHashSet;Lorg/hibernate/service/classloading/spi/ClassLoaderService;)V
at org.hibernate.service.internal.BootstrapServiceRegistryImpl.<init>(BootstrapServiceRegistryImpl.java:80)
at org.hibernate.service.internal.BootstrapServiceRegistryImpl.<init>(BootstrapServiceRegistryImpl.java:57)
at org.hibernate.service.ServiceRegistryBuilder.<init>(ServiceRegistryBuilder.java:76)
at com.you.hibernate.HibernateSessionFactory.<clinit>(HibernateSessionFactory.java:33)
at com.you.hibernate.dao.StudentDao.findAll(StudentDao.java:25)
at com.you.hibernate.dao.StudentDao.main(StudentDao.java:39)
2、错误原因
/**
*
*/
package com.you.hibernate.dao;
import java.util.ArrayList;
import java.util.List;
import org.hibernate.Session;
import org.hibernate.query.Query;
import com.you.hibernate.HibernateSessionFactory;
import com.you.hibernate.model.TStudentInfo;
/**
* @author Administrator
*
*/
public class StudentDao
{
@SuppressWarnings({ "unchecked", "rawtypes" })
public static List<TStudentInfo> findAll()
{
List<TStudentInfo> list = null;
Session session = HibernateSessionFactory.getSession();
Query query = session.createQuery("from TStudentInfo ");
list = query.list();
session.close();
return list;
}
/**
* @param args
*/
public static void main(String[] args)
{
List<TStudentInfo> list = new ArrayList<TStudentInfo>();
list = findAll();
System.out.println(list.size());
}
}
3、解决办法
相关文章推荐
- Caused by: java.lang.AbstractMethodError: org.hibernate.validator.internal.engine.ConfigurationImpl
- java.lang.NoClassDefFoundError: org/hibernate/service/jta/platform/spi/JtaPlatform
- java.lang.ClassNotFoundException: org.hibernate.service.jta.platform.spi.JtaPlatform
- Hibernate遇到Caused by: java.lang.NoSuchMethodError: org.hibernate.annotations.common.util.impl.L
- java.lang.ClassCastException: org.hibernate.impl.QueryImpl cannot be cast to UserActivity
- java.lang.NoSuchMethodError: org.hibernate.internal.CoreMessageLogger.debugf(Ljava/lang/String;I)V
- java.lang.IllegalStateException: No data type for node: org.hibernate.hql.internal.ast.tree.IdentNod
- java.lang.ClassCastException: org.hibernate.impl.SQLQueryImpl cannot be cast to java.util.List
- java.lang.NoClassDefFoundError: org/hibernate/internal/util/xml/Origin
- Caused by: java.lang.ClassNotFoundException: org.hibernate.service.jta.platform.spi.JtaPlatform
- Caused by: java.lang.ClassNotFoundException: org.hibernate.impl.SessionImpl
- java.lang.ClassCastException: com.sun.org.apache.xerces.internal.dom.DeferredTextImpl cannot be cas
- java.lang.ClassCastException: com.sun.org.apache.xerces.internal.dom.DeferredCommentImpl cannot be c
- java.lang.IllegalStateException: No data type for node: org.hibernate.hql.internal.ast.tree.IdentNod
- java.lang.NoClassDefFoundError: Could not initialize class org.hibernate.validator.internal.engine.m
- java.lang.NoSuchMethodError: com.sun.org.apache.xerces.internal.impl.XMLDocumentScannerImpl.getNamespaceContext()
- spring配置出错at org.hibernate.engine.jdbc.internal.JdbcServicesImpl.configure(JdbcServicesImpl.java:244
- java.lang.NoClassDefFoundError: org/hibernate/service/jta/platform/spi/JtaPlatform
- Caused by: java.lang.ClassNotFoundException: org.hibernate.service.jta.platform.spi.JtaPlatform
- java.lang.ClassCastException: org.hibernate.impl.SessionFactoryImpl cannot be cast to org.springfram